Non Destructive Testing // Magnetic Particles

DUBL-CHEK BLACK OXIDE No. 1
Visible Magnetic Particle
  • Particles are easily agitated, fast acting and produce defined indications
  • Particles meet specification requirements
  • Can be used with both stationary and portable magnetic test equipment
  • Can be used at elevated temperatures
  • Water based suspension is non-flammable

Description

DUBL-CHEK Black Oxide No. 1 is black magnetic oxide particle that can be suspended in a highly refined light petroleum oil or water. The particles respond to magnetic leakage fields created by discontinuities in ferromagnetic material. Particles rapidly collect at leakage fields producing black indications.

Physical Properties

Particle Colour: Black
Specific Gravity: 0.4 g/ml
Particle Size: 0.5 – 4.0 µm (average 1.5µm)
Temperature limit: 0°C to 50°C

Directions

Water Suspension: The water must be conditioned before adding the Black Oxide No.1 in order to disperse the particles wet the test surface and inhibit corrosion. W5-C is the recommended conditioner and is added at 10g/Lt. Black Oxide No.1 should be added at a concentration of 15g/Lt.
Settlement Test: The settlement test, using a pear-shaped centrifuge tube, is essential to check the particle concentration and contamination to the suspension. This SHALL be performed on the initial batch, an adjustment made to the concentration, or at each shift change. The Settlement Test methods and particle concentrations can be found in relevant standards. The recommended volume is between 1.2 and 2.5 ml and will vary from one specification to another. The concentration may be adjusted by adding more MPF, water or Black Oxide No.1 as required.

1. Clean the test surface and allow it to dry.
2. Apply DUBL-CHEK CP-2 for background contrast, if required.
3. Magnetise the area to be inspected.
4. Ensure continuous agitation of the suspension.
5. Apply the suspension to the test part at a distance of approximately 150mm from surface.
6. Allow the excess oil/water to run off the inspection area.
7. Inspect the surface under visible light.
8. Collections of Black Oxide No.1 particles will reveal discontinuities at the leakage fields.
9. Clean and repeat the process; changing the orientation of the magnetising direction.
